  • Wall paint spots all over my car

    Help.i have wall paints all over my car.they are small, maybe came from air from someone using paint spray near my car instead direct spills.
    Ive try uc and applicator pad n put lotta passion but seems dont works good.
    N my arms is hurt now.
    What should i do?
    Do clay works consider they are above surface defects?
    Or what?
    Thanks.

  • #2
    Re: Wall paint spots all over my car

    I would try the mild (blue) clay. Plenty of lube also.

        • #5
          Re: Wall paint spots all over my car

          If claying doesn't work I've had great success with #6 Cleaner Wax (any of Meg's cleaners should do) when removing spray paint overspray. Just have to use a little passion and work it in.

          • #6
            Re: Wall paint spots all over my car

            My first experience with clay was back in 1996 when a customer ran over a freshly-painted highway line in my then-new Jimmy company car. It took some time and effort, but came out perfect. No compounds, no buffer, no swirls. Sold me forever on the value of clay.
